  1. 1.  Edith Evelyn Hawks was born on 12 Jan 1907 in Elmo, Dickinson County, Kansas; died on 3 May 2007 in Wichita, Sedgwick County, Kansas; was buried in White Chapel Memorial Gardens, Wichita, Sedgwick County, Kansas.

    Notes:

    Nighswonger, Edith Evelyn (Hawks), beloved mother and grandmother, went to be with her Savior on May 3, 2007. She was 100 years old. Visitation with family 2:00-4:00 pm, Sunday, Broadway Mortuary. Funeral service 10:30 am, Monday, Immanuel Baptist Church. Edith was born January 12, 1907 to Frank and Lydia Hawks. She married Lawrence Richard Nighswonger on August 25, 1935. Prior to raising her family, she worked at Swenson Safety Corner. She was a charter member of Immanuel Baptist Church, where she was a member for over 75 years. Edith was preceded in death by her husband and daughter, Judy Simmons. She is survived by her children, Larry and Sherry Nighswonger of Wichita, Karen and Bud Smith of Independence, MO and Gene Simmons of August, KS; 6 grandchildren and their spouses; and 11 great-grandchildren. Memorial have been established with Immanuel Baptist Church and Harry Hynes Memorial Hospice. Services by Broadway Mortuary.

    The Wichita Eagle, Wichita, Kansas. Saturday, 5 May 2007

    Edith married Lawrence Richard Nighswonger on 25 Aug 1933 in Wichita, Sedgwick County, Kansas. Lawrence (son of William Peter Nighswonger and Anna Cloadine Parker) was born on 8 Jun 1900 in Viola, Sedgwick County, Kansas; died on 20 Feb 1974 in Wichita, Sedgwick County, Kansas; was buried in White Chapel Memorial Gardens, Wichita, Sedgwick County, Kansas.
